Peer RBC Ratios - 2002
  • AEGON 348.8
  • Hartford 236.7
  • ING 341.7
  • Jackson National 277.7
  • Jefferson Pilot 315.3
  • John Hancock 305.3
  • Lincoln 335.0
  • Manulife 228.2
  • Met Life 280.3
  • Nationwide 325.5
  • Pacific Life 279.4
  • Prudential 316.0
  • Travelers 376.6
  • In most instances, the peer companies RBC ratio
    is the groups single dominant life company. If
    there is not a single major company, the groups
    weighted average ratio is calculated. AEGONs
    RBC ratio is based on our consolidated statutory
    statements.
